If this is your very first time, begin with 38C. You might wish to stay at this temperature level for a couple of sessions. You can always enhance the temperature each session till you get to 65C. For newbie users, start with 15 minutes. You can add time each session until you reach the suggested time of 30 to 45 mins.


You do not intend to remain in there too lengthy and danger ending up being dried out. How you gown is your choice. Most individuals will certainly use swimwear. If you really feel ill or have a fever, it's finest to wait to utilize the sauna till you're really feeling better. Utilizing an infrared sauna will certainly trigger you to sweat a whole lot, so you may feel lightheaded when you stand. If this happens, see to it you stand up gradually and take a seat as soon as you leave the sauna.


In severe situations, some people may experience overheating (warm stroke and warmth fatigue) or dehydration. If you have any health problems such as hypertension, heart troubles, or are under treatment, get removed by your doctor prior to your first session. Despite the fact that infrared saunas have actually been found to be rather risk-free, you don't intend to take any kind of chances when it involves your health and wellness and security.

Typical saunas typically range in between 150 and 185 degrees F. This amount of heat is best for click over here some individuals, yet it can be a little frustrating for those who are extra heat-sensitive.


Due to the fact that the warm from infrared saunas penetrates much deeper right into the body, they're able to create as much sweat and offer a lot of the very same benefits without reaching the greater temperature levels of a conventional sauna. An additional difference in between the two designs is the quantity of steam they generate. Some standard saunas utilize water over warmed rocks to generate steam, which promotes sweating at lower temperatures than conventional dry saunas.
